High Precision Circle Drawing Tool

This is a nifty addition to the studio. It does require a little patience to operate, as it is a bit hard to turn the face of the tool to size the circle to the smallest setting. The tool gets stuck at 1 1/2 cm mark and I have to use the screws on the back of the device to move it down to 1 cm. The larger the circle gets, the easier the tool turns. Beware of the edges of the inside of the circle, they are sharp and will damage your drawing utensil if rubbed against. This tool takes the time of making perfect circles by hand away so you can focus more on the overall work instead of minor details. I can also use this as a “curve gauge” to help get the same line curves in some of my more abstract art or different line curves in proportion for designing. Nice quality and heavy-duty product.
